Toilet Leak Repair in Denver, CO
Toilet leak repair services address issues where a toilet is wasting water or causing damage due to leaks. These projects typically involve identifying the source of the leak, which can include faulty flappers, worn-out seals, cracked bowls, or issues with the supply line or tank components. Homeowners often request this service when noticing signs such as constant running, water pooling around the base, increased water bills, or a foul odor indicating hidden leaks. Proper repair helps prevent further water waste and potential property damage, ensuring the toilet functions efficiently and reliably.

Toilet Leak Repair Questions
What causes a toilet to leak? Common causes include worn flappers, faulty fill valves, or loose connections that allow water to escape.
How can I tell if my toilet is leaking? Signs include constant running water, water pooling around the base, or increased water bills without increased usage.
Is a leaking toilet damaging my property? Yes, persistent leaks can lead to water damage, mold growth, and increased repair costs if not addressed promptly.
What types of leak repairs are typically needed? Repairs often involve replacing flappers, tightening fittings, or fixing cracks in the tank or bowl.
